I'm running a VF34 91 octane map. I have not experience any pinging at all. I't's boosting at ~19 PSI with the 3/16 restrictor mod (16 PSI with the oem) and
a TXS TMIC ver. 2
Acceleration is very smooth and boost holds and very stable at 19 PSI (no spikes at all). I haven't dyno the car yet so I can't give you an estimate but it's good enough for my application.
